Output 59b2c24f153d360bcf80c8405e37719fccdfd25c701ee9d4e27fff29be2a4d41:3

value
905600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8a2ce1ba82ead07aa91cc017e328223bd2d777 OP_EQUAL
address
34PD3hLiiKo3PY6oTNWPWz7BRN7G2sEBKc
transaction
59b2c24f153d360bcf80c8405e37719fccdfd25c701ee9d4e27fff29be2a4d41